Chapter 5 Goryeo Chaos (6)

Ma Sanbao sat on the table next to the window, looking out the window. The people outside were bustling and sighed in his heart, Nanjing is really a world of flowers, the streets of Peking are rustic, and there is no place where there is vitality. The bustling in every corner of this city makes Ma Sanbao curious.

A fortune teller walked to the south of the street, wearing a square scarf, holding a cloth banner in his hand, muttering words in his mouth, and glanced at the direction of the restaurant from time to time.

Twenty or thirty steps north, two big men in short clothes were squatting, wearing a towel on their shoulders and holding a shoulder pole while chatting, as if they were two coolies waiting for work.

A scholar in the street facing the window was walking into a teahouse facing the street, sat down at a table at the door, and asked the guy to serve tea.

On the table next to him were two middle-aged men dressed in businessmen, drinking tea and eating broad beans. An old man in the teahouse was talking in a daze, but the two merchants seemed to not listen and stared at the door of the restaurant from time to time.

Further north was a beggar, squatting at the entrance of the alley, with a broken bowl in front of him, and a few money was thrown sparsely inside.

Ma Sanbao's eyes moved to the building, and there were four young men sitting next to the stairs, dressed in a literati, but their faces were dark and strong. The four of them didn't speak, they only knew how to bury their heads and drink.

Under the north window was a middle-aged man, dressed in gorgeous clothes, and placed two dishes and a pot of wine in front of him, but he rarely used his chopsticks.

To the south is a wall, and a young man sat on the table there. He looked a little nervous and looked up from time to time to look at the entrance of the stairs.

Ma Sanbao cursed secretly, if these bastards were experienced veterans, the words "ambush" were engraved on their foreheads.

Everyone in the two teahouses knew that they had not heard of the storytellers; how could the beggar have such clean hands? And his expression clearly was not telling everyone, is it okay for me to give it or not? And the fortune teller, who had walked back and forth on the street for two times, was not like a fortune teller who wanted to tell someone fortune. The four brothers at the stairs were even more inexplicable. Who made them dress up as scholars? Have you ever seen such a dark and stunning scholar?

Ma Sanbao shook his head in pain. It seemed that after returning to Peking, these people must train more lurking skills. Otherwise, sooner or later, something bad happened. He could only hope that the four people lie in the back of the restaurant would pretend to be like some.

Ma Sanbao was very dissatisfied with the mission to come to the south. Those stupid Koreans received reports from the other party that they wanted to take action, but they didn't know how to start first. They insisted on setting up a bureau in Jiangbei Pavilion, trying to get the other party all in one place. Now, the other party was not beaten up, but instead took the life of Lord Zheng. The traitor was also very ineffective in doing things, and the information he gave was not accurate at all. In Jiangning Town, he took his brothers to a trip, but he didn't even get any hair.

However, the prince seemed to attach great importance to this operation. Not only did he send out thirty most capable guards, he also personally told himself to cooperate with the Goryeo before leaving. These guys who were not good at doing anything were enough to make trouble. As he thought about it, Ma Sanbao stared at the young man sitting by the wall with his eyes slanted.

The young man looked anxiously at the sky outside the window, and he had gone to the cottage four times since time to time. He had to be nervous. Last night, Wang Luchao sent someone to send a message to him, saying that he would meet here at You hour today, and he sent a message to his master overnight. The master ordered him to cooperate with Wang Luchao to catch him today. He arrived at the restaurant at three o'clock in Shen Shi. He ordered a few side dishes and ordered a pot of Longjing. He had been waiting for half an hour, but he still didn't see Wang Luchao appear.

At this time, his heart felt as uncomfortable as being scratched by a cat's paws, and his undercover life was finally over. For such a long time, he stayed by the prince of the deceased kingdom, unable to eat or sleep well. His wife and children at home had not seen each other for several years. He was about to go crazy in such a day. He originally thought that Wang Yao's fall was his day to make a move, but his superiors did not dare to take action in Nanjing and insisted on inviting someone else to enter Beijing with the mission. The officials and men above really didn't know whether they had their brains in their minds or what. They finally reported information about the assassination of Lord Zheng, but they insisted on setting up a plan to catch all the people from the Goryeo Dynasty.

After the failure of the operation, Wang Luchao and several subordinates ran out to let everyone break through. They originally agreed to gather in Jiangning Town together, but the assassination alarmed the military officers of the five cities. After a few days, the city gates were checked and the entry and exit were extremely strict. Some people who could not speak Chinese were arrested, causing Wang Luchao to disband everyone and lurk. Last night, news finally came. As long as Wang Luchao was caught, he could finally forgive his original sins. After the boss said that after the matter was completed, he immediately put himself in a county to be the county magistrate. For him, this was simply a ghost to become a god. He was a man who was about to be beheaded, but now he had the opportunity to become an official again. After a while, he could straighten his back and meet his wife and children. Thinking of this, an excited red color appeared on his face.

Now it is approaching the third hour of You, the sun has completely set, and more and more people are eating up the stairs. Every time someone comes up on the stairs, the guests from the four tables from south, south, west and north will look at the entrance of the stairs at the same time. Then the people from other tables will look at the people against the wall at the same time. Almost everyone who comes up will be treated the same way. But except for his anxiously lowering his head, there is no agreed code.

Ma Sanbao couldn't sit still anymore. He saw the already tired fortune teller squatting on the street and looking at him anxiously; the two coolies who would never take care of their jobs bought two bowls of tea and started drinking; the few people next to the stairs stopped drinking, because they might have to get drunk if they drink again.

A guy carrying water was walking downstairs.

Did something go wrong? Wang Luchao saw his arrangement? No, judging from the clumsy assassination and stupid escape routes of these deceased people, they would not have any experience, so why didn't they come?

Novice hurriedly walked through the restaurant carrying a bucket. A wine flag fluttered in the wind in the vague lights, and the three dragons and phoenixes in Jixianlou were written on it. He noticed that the fortune teller was still wandering here, and the two coolies who had not left at night. Of course, the businessman who was not very good at listening to books in the teahouse did not escape his eyes. This was the second time he had walked through the restaurant in an hour. What were the people who had been staying here? Now he could go back and report his life, and the matter above had basically understood what the above was asking for reconnaissance.

"What? Is it him?" When Wang Luchao heard Xiao Chenzi's report, he was surprised and speechless.

The mole hidden beside Wang Luchao is Xu Fengjin who appears in Jixian Building. Wang Luchao is very reluctant to accept this fact. Because among these people, Xu Fengjin has the best martial arts skills, is the most capable, and is one of Wang Luchao's most trusted people. His background cannot be a traitor in any case.

Zhu Zhi said: "Although the young master is unwilling to accept this fact, the fact is the fact, and the traitor is the traitor. Now as long as you nod, the nail that has betrayed so many of your subordinates will be pulled out."

Wang Luchao buried his head in his hands in pain. After Xu Fengjin surfaced, many unexplainable things in the past could finally be explained. For example, why during the Jiangbei Pavilion, Zheng Daochuan happened to break through Xu Fengjin's direction.

Zhu Zhi said again: "Young master, you don't know the people's face. Even if you dig out one of him, you can't be sure that there is no one around him. Especially those who have voted in the past year must carefully review it."

Wang Luchao murmured: "This damn dog thief actually recognizes the thief as his father. His father was indeed killed by Li thief, so I didn't expect it to be this person no matter what. Since that's the case, please help Your Highness get rid of this traitor."

When the time entered the hour of Xu, Ma Sanbao no longer had the patience to wait. He slapped a 10-liang treasure bill on the table and shouted, "My friend's account." The guy walked over and looked at the treasure bill on the table, and put it away unhappily. Ma Sanbao stood up, walked towards the stairs, and passed by Xu Fengjin, stared at him fiercely.

Xu Fengjin walked back to his residence along the alley with his tired body. His heart, which had been nervous for a day, finally relaxed. But his heart was filled with endless loneliness. What should he do? Wang Luchao did not come, and his suffering was still unliberated. When will this undercover life end? At this time, he felt the infernal pain mentioned in the Nirvana Sutra in his heart.

"Swoosh" Xu Fengjin, who was opening the door, suddenly felt a chill in his vest, and an arrow protruded from his chest, with bright red blood on it. This was his last consciousness in his life.

After killing Xu Fengjin, Zhu Zhi ordered Xiao Chenzi to find a quiet place in the city to buy a house and arrange for Wang Luchao brothers and sisters and his men to live there. After all, they always live in the palace and have a big goal. Zhu Zhi told them to hide with peace of mind and wait for the opportunity. Wang Luchao suffered a great loss and was much more anxious, so the two brothers and sisters stayed in the garden as apartment.

You and I will come on stage after the show in Goryeo. Just after dealing with the Wang brothers and sisters, Li Chenggui's gift list floated to the surface again. The Ministry of Justice found these two documents in the case files handed over by the Five City Military and Horses. It was okay to say what was given to Zhu Yuanzhang, but the gift list presented to King Yan would be a big problem.

Yang Jing, the Minister of the Evocational Ministry, did not dare to act rashly, and delivered the gift list to Zhu Yuanzhang overnight. Although Zhu Yuanzhang loved Zhu Di, this obvious usurpation also made him furious. Seeing this, Yang Jing immediately submitted a copy and asked the King of Yan to punish him for usurpation.

When the news reached Zhu Zhi's mansion, Yang Rong threw the information on the table contemptuously and said to Zhu Zhi: "These fools, in this way, the King of Yan will be free of worries."

Zhu Zhi said: "Mianren, don't you just hope that King Yan can be safe in this matter?"

Yang Rong said: "From the future development of Your Highness, the King of Yan cannot fail, but this matter is a great opportunity to weaken the King of Yan. Originally, as long as the ministers below remained silent and asked the emperor to deal with it themselves, the King of Yan would learn a lesson either big or small. But now Yang Shangshu thought he had caught the handle and impeached the book. But how could the emperor not know that he was the one who protects the grandson? According to the emperor's temper, he naturally would not be willing to punish the King of Yan. It turned out that His Highness still had the opportunity to dissuade the emperor. Now it seems that even this trouble is spared."

Sure enough, within three days, Lao Zhu issued two imperial edicts in a row. One imperial edict rebuked Yang Jing for alienating the relationship between father and son and fined him three months of salary; the other imperial edict rebuked the King of Yan for not understanding etiquette and law, and punished him for sending the prince to Fengyang to guard the ancestral tomb for half a year. Both imperial edicts were lightly punished by both parties, but a discerning person could tell at a glance that Zhu Yuanzhang was protecting his son. Yang Jing wrote a letter to tell the King of Yan about the mistakes of violating the rules, but Zhu Yuanzhang beat him with a stick, which obviously warned everyone not to attack the King of Yan again.

The worst thing is that Li Chenggui's mission was sent to the delegation, and the official envoy was killed. The five cities' military commanders kicked the ball to the Ministry of Justice. The Ministry of Justice said that the Heavenly Kingdom did not recognize your vassal, and we didn't know how to manage it. He kicked the ball to the Ministry of Rites. The Ministry of Rites spoke, and you threw the murder case to my Ministry of Rites. Where did this go? You don't care, I don't care. Just kicked the ball between several yamen, and it was finally left alone. The delegation had no choice but to send people to report it back to the country and ask the country to send envoys to pay tribute.

In a few days, information came from Peking. The newly reprimanded King Yan scattered all his anger on the eunuch Ma Sanbao. He was demoted to Tongzhou to raise horses because of his poor work. The biggest winner in the whole incident became Zhu Zhi, the Liao king who had been hiding behind him. With this information, Zhu Zhi thought of this arrogant King Yan. He couldn't even understand how the emperor could know about this matter, and he didn't understand why Wang Luchao and his gang disappeared without a trace like water dripping into the sea.
